Property Description

Set against the backdrop of Santa Barbara's storied Riviera, this private 1920s Craftsman residence carries both architectural pedigree and timeless charm. Originally envisioned by famed architect Francis W. Wilson for Madame Elise Bachmann, a pioneering New York dressmaker and one of the first to build on the Riviera, this home stands as a hallmark of the neighborhood's early elegance and enduring spirit.Showcasing sweeping ocean and city views, the main residence blends the warmth of wood-paneled living spaces with refined period details. The home offers three bedrooms and three baths upstairs, plus a bedroom, office, TV room, and full bath on the main level, creating a flexible layout ideal for modern living.
